What this diode does
Provides rectification and directional current flow using a metal–semiconductor (Schottky) junction rather than a p–n junction.
Offers rapid turnon/turnoff behavior and minimal stored charge, which lowers switching losses and EMI in fast converters.
Acts as a clamp or protection device to prevent reverse polarity or voltage spikes from damaging sensitive circuits.

Practical use scenarios
Switchmode power supplies (buck/boost converters): Use as output rectifiers or synchronousreplacement diodes to reduce losses and improve converter efficiency at low voltages.
Reversepolarity and transient protection: Place at power inputs or across sensitive rails to block reverse current and clamp transients with minimal voltage drop.
frequency signal detection and RF circuits: Use for envelope detection or mixer diodes where fast response and low junction capacitance improve sensitivity.
Design and selection notes (practical considerations)
Choose packaging that matches your assembly method (SMD for automated pickandplace, throughhole for prototyping or current leads).
Verify the diode's maximum reverse voltage and continuous current ratings against your application requirements.
Consider thermal management: although Schottky diodes have lower forward drop, currents still require attention to PCB copper area or heatsinking.
Check leakage current at operating temperature; Schottky diodes typically have higher reverse leakage than silicon p–n diodes, which can matter in standby or leakagesensitive circuits.
